General Information Notice Type: Presolicitation / Sources Sought Project Title: Employee Onboarding Training Video Proposed Solicitation Number: TBD Agency / Office: Department of War / US Air Force / 30 CONS/ PKB Location: Lompoc, CA 93437 NAICS Code: 512110 (Motion Picture and Video Production) Product Service Code (PSC): T006 (Photo/Map/Print/Publication�Film/Video Tape Production) Posting Date 5/12/2026 Anticipated Solicitation Date: 5/27/2026 Description of Requirement BACKGROUND To enhance the effectiveness and accessibility of 30 FSS onboarding training, the squadron requires the development of a modern, engaging training video for new employees. Traditional training methods can be time-consuming and lack the engagement needed for effective knowledge retention. This project will convert an existing training slide deck into a streamlined, high-impact video to better embed key concepts and enhance learner engagement 2.0 MINIMUM SPECIFICATIONS The primary objective is to produce a 60-minute training video based on a Government-furnished slide deck. The final product will be a professional, easy-to-understand, and inclusive training tool. � Develop one 60-minute training video for supervisor and leadership training. � Use the Government-provided training slide deck as the primary source of information. � Create a smart, streamlined video that is engaging for the target audience. � Structure the video into logical sections that correspond with the sections in the training slide deck. � Incorporate professional voice-over and on-screen captions to enhance understanding and inclusiveness. � Ensure the final video has a logical structure and is easy to comprehend. � Ensure the final video has 1920 x 1080 (Full HD) resolution and has optimal video quality of at least 25 fps. � Ensure the final video has high-quality audio to ensure viewer engagement and retention. 3.0 DESCRIPTION OF WORK The contractor shall provide all necessary services to create and deliver a complete, high-quality training video. � Contractor shall review the Government-furnished training slide deck to understand the content and learning objectives. � Contractor shall develop a script and storyboard for the video, organizing the content into logical sections that mirror the slide deck. � Contractor shall create all necessary graphics, animations, and visual elements to produce an engaging video. � Contractor shall record a professional voice-over for the entire video. � Contractor shall produce and edit the video to a final length of approximately 60 minutes. � Contractor shall integrate synchronized captions (closed captioning) into the final video. � Contractor shall deliver a draft version of the video to the Government representative for review and feedback. � Contractor shall incorporate Government feedback and deliver the final video file in a standard, high-definition format (e.g., MP4). 4.0 COMPLIANCE The Vendor shall comply with all applicable federal, state, local, and county laws, as well as Air Force regulations governing the execution of these services. 5.0 PERIOD OF PERFORMANCE The project shall be completed between 1 July 2026 and 30 June 2027. The complete digitization and upload of all records should take no longer than 180 calendar days from the project start date. 6.0 GOVERNMENT FURNISHED PROPERTY/INFORMATION 6.1 Government Furnished Items �Training Content: The Government will provide the complete training slide deck that will serve as the source material for the video. 6.2 Government Furnished Equipment � N/A 6.3 Government Furnished Services �Consultation: The Government will provide a point of contact to clarify information from the slide deck as needed. �Review and Feedback: The Government will provide timely review and feedback on the draft video Regulatory Authority and Acquisition Strategy This notice is published in accordance with the Revolutionary FAR Overhaul (RFO) 5.101 and 12.201-1 for acquisitions at or below the Simplified Acquisition Threshold (SAT), as supplemented by Department of War (DoW) guidance, including DFARS Deviation 2026-O0003 and 2026-O0028.
